Another Legacy vs. Maitreya opinion.
I have several drafted posts at this point, it seems this blog is bound to remain a continual work in progress if I can't just DO something about it, so skipping intros and all else, I'll start here.
TL;DR - I got the Legacy, I love it, I'm never using it again.
I purchased the Legacy body on sale recently because as much as I'm enjoying my Maitreya Lara 5.2, I'm always looking for change and I'd been hearing so much about the level of detail and the beautiful shape so I thought I'd check it out. I also took the Classic gift for good measure, and I strongly recommend it as a starter body. It's only $L1 and has a lot more options than any free body I've seen, including the many altamura offerings. I'm not the biggest fan of the HUD, but it seems Maitreya has that on lockdown. They have the most straightforward, well sized, easy to understand, common sense HUD I've ever encountered. Practically zero learning curve there.
Legacy has them beat with the beauty of this body, the detail, the shape. I put it on my regular shape and went from "oh, that's nice" to "oh my goooooodness" real quick and then adjusted my shape so the Lara would more closely mirror the look of the Legacy even though it's not quite. I had to though! I had to stick with my Lara. I only have 2 reasons for sticking with Maitreya. Firstly and leastly, I am not a fan of going backward with this separate hands and feet business but if that were the only reason I'd get over it. However, my main issue, the issue I can't get past while I have the option to avoid it, is this:
What on earth. I checked it with the classic as well, there's some kind of alpha type conflict with the edges of the body and light colors. Like how hair used to cut up eyebrows (if your hair still cuts up your eyebrows, check for updates). Somehow they managed to not have this issue with the feet, but watching myself walk around with a weird outline to my ankles and wrists is just a nonstarter. I'm holding onto hope that they'll update and fix this, but their...ahem...history....makes me concerned that won't happen and I'm just out ~$L2500 because I was bored.
